Kathleen Marie Mooney Davis, age 73, of Roseville, died October 27, 2025 after a long battle with Alzheimer’s.
Kathy was preceded in death by her father, Phil, and most recently her mother, Dallasjean.
Kathy is survived by her children, Jay (Rachel) and Erica; grandchildren, Cassidy, Josh, and Zack; great-granddaughter, Lila; and siblings, Maureen (Ken) Deceuster, Dennis Mooney, Laurie Bies, Terrie (Don) Luedtke, Tom (Sandy) Mooney, and Annmarie (Chad) Radenbaugh.
Kathy grew up in Como Park. She attended St Andrew's, St Agnes, beauty school, and later graduated from Metropolitan State. Kathy worked in insurance claims most of her career. She also ran a beauty salon business out of her home. Kathy loved golfing, walks around Como Lake, and spending time with her family and many friends. She will be dearly missed.
A Mass of Christian Burial for both Kathy and Dallas will be held on Thursday, November 6 at 10:30 AM at Maternity of Mary Catholic Church, 1414 N Dale St, St. Paul. Combined visitation will be held from 4-7 PM Wednesday, November 5 at Mueller-Bies Funeral Home (Roseville), 2130 N Dale St at Co Rd B, Roseville, and from 9:30-10:30 AM Thursday at the church. Private interment at Roselawn Cemetery.
